try: | |
from typing import Annotated | |
except ImportError: | |
# Backported Annotated, available through https://pypi.org/project/typing-extensions/. | |
from typing_extensions import Annotated | |
class Model(Base): | |
# This docstring is automatically extended with types and defaults. | |
# Maybe one of the following existing projects could be reused for this: | |
# https://github.com/agronholm/sphinx-autodoc-typehints | |
# https://www.sphinx-doc.org/en/2.0/usage/extensions/autodoc.html#generating-documents-from-type-annotations | |
# A similar approach could be used to extract default values out as well. | |
"""This is a cool model. | |
Parameters | |
---------- | |
penalty: | |
This is a something cool. | |
- This is a list | |
- Another list | |
n_jobs: | |
This is parallel. | |
Attributes | |
---------- | |
n_features_: | |
The number of features when ``fit`` is performed. | |
estimators_: | |
The collection of fitted sub-estimators. | |
""" | |
# So this allows mypy and IDEs to know which properties are available on the object. | |
n_features_: int | |
estimators_: List[sklearn.tree.DecisionTreeClassifier] | |
# If there has to be any special handling of default values for backwards compatibility reasons, | |
# or some other special processing where it is imporant to know if parameter was passed in or not, | |
# then we should use a decorator to help with that, but keep the original constructor signature. | |
def __init__(self, *, | |
penalty: Annotated[str, Enum("l2", "l1", "elasticnet", "none")] = "l2", | |
n_jobs: Annotated[Union[int, str], Interval(int, lower=1) + Enum(-1, None), Tags('resource')] = None, | |
): | |
self.penalty = penalty | |
self.n_jobs = n_jobs |
